Detailed Report on Chime's Financial Innovations

In the evolving realm of personal finance, Chime has emerged as a significant player, carving out a niche with its mobile-first approach. Established as a financial technology company, rather than a bank itself, Chime meticulously partners with esteemed FDIC-insured banks such as The Bancorp Bank N.A. and Stride Bank N.A. This strategic collaboration guarantees that all user deposits are safeguarded up to the federal limit of $250,000, mirroring the security provided by traditional banking institutions.

Chime's primary allure lies in its commitment to eliminating hidden costs and simplifying financial management. It distinguishes itself by offering banking services devoid of monthly maintenance fees, overdraft penalties, or minimum balance requirements, a stark contrast to many legacy banking models. This fee-free structure is particularly appealing to a broad demographic, from young adults navigating their initial banking experiences to individuals striving to manage their finances more efficiently.

A cornerstone of Chime's innovative suite is its checking account, which comes bundled with a Chime Visa Debit Card. Users benefit from real-time transaction alerts, convenient mobile check deposits, and instantaneous transfers between Chime accounts. Furthermore, the platform grants access to an extensive network of over 60,000 fee-free ATMs across the MoneyPass and Allpoint networks, ensuring widespread accessibility to funds. Chime also extends a vital lifeline through its second-chance checking account, catering to those who may have faced account denials from conventional banks due to past financial setbacks.

For savings, Chime presents an attractive proposition with competitive Annual Percentage Yields (APYs) on its savings accounts, reaching up to 3.75% for eligible Chime+ members. The platform integrates intelligent savings tools like 'Round-Ups,' which automatically rounds up debit card transactions to the nearest dollar and transfers the difference into savings, and 'Save When I Get Paid,' allowing users to automatically allocate a percentage of their direct deposits to their savings. These features foster a seamless savings habit, removing the friction often associated with building a financial cushion.

Addressing immediate financial needs, Chime introduces 'SpotMe,' a unique feature providing fee-free overdraft protection of up to $200 for qualified users. This service, akin to a cash advance, activates automatically on debit card purchases once a user meets certain eligibility criteria, typically involving regular direct deposits. Complementing this is 'MyPay,' an earned wage access tool enabling eligible employees to access a portion of their earned wages before their scheduled payday, offering a crucial bridge during unexpected financial shortfalls. Both SpotMe and MyPay are pivotal in helping users navigate cash flow challenges without incurring exorbitant fees.

Beyond transactional banking, Chime actively supports credit building through its 'Credit Builder' secured Visa credit card. This card, requiring no annual fees or interest and bypassing hard credit checks for application, empowers users to establish or improve their credit scores safely. By reporting on-time payments to all three major credit bureaus, the Credit Builder card offers a straightforward path to financial stability for those new to credit or embarking on a journey to rebuild it.

Moreover, Chime enhances its value proposition with 'Chime Deals,' a program offering rotating cashback rewards on select debit card purchases. This feature adds another layer of financial benefit, allowing users to earn rewards directly through their everyday spending. The platform's commitment to user convenience is further evidenced by its 'Chime+' membership tier, automatically unlocked through qualifying direct deposits, which amplifies benefits such as higher savings APYs, extended SpotMe coverage, and priority customer support, demonstrating Chime's dedication to rewarding active engagement.

In essence, Chime positions itself as a modern financial solution, ideally suited for individuals who embrace digital platforms and seek a transparent, cost-effective, and feature-rich banking experience. Its comprehensive suite of tools, from early direct deposit and overdraft protection to credit building and automated savings, collectively empowers users to achieve greater financial autonomy and peace of mind in an increasingly digital world.
